Varun Dhawan has made history as the youngest Bollywood actor with a Madame Tussauds wax statue in Sydney, Australia.

The official Instagram handle of Madame Tussauds uploaded a reel featuring Varun’s wax statue placed next to superstar Shah Rukh Khan’s statue.

The video further offered a peek into how female fans from around the world excitedly click photos with the statue and admire Dhawan's popular hook step of Disco Deewane from his debut movie titled Student of the Year.

The Kalank actor reposted the video on his Instagram stories and expressed his happiness saying, “Sydney, I'm in your city. Come check out whenever. I'll just be standing there for U guys.”


On the work front, Dhawan is prepping for his first-ever collaboration with famous filmmaker Atlee for Baby John, remake of the 2016 movie Theri. 

To note, Varun Dhawan also has the Indian spin-off of web series Citadel, Honey Bunny lined up with Samantha Ruth Prabhu.
